> Le 28/03/2024 à 05:55, Rohan McLure a écrit :
>> Support page table check on all PowerPC platforms. This works by
>> serialising assignments, reassignments and clears of page table
>> entries at each level in order to ensure that anonymous mappings
>> have at most one writable consumer, and likewise that file-backed
>> mappings are not simultaneously also anonymous mappings.
>>
>> In order to support this infrastructure, a number of stubs must be
>> defined for all powerpc platforms. Additionally, seperate set_pte_at()
>> and set_pte_at_unchecked(), to allow for internal, uninstrumented 
>> mappings.
